Abnormal plasma cells in Philippine hemorrhagic fever

ABSTRACT
The hemorrhagic changes observed in 35 selected cases of Philippine hemorrhagic fever is described particularly the findings of abnormal plasma cells. The identification of this cell from other cellular elements of the peripheral blood is given. Correlations with the degree of leukopenia, onset of illness and abnormal platelets are made. The significance of this abnormal plasma cells in the diagnosis of the disease is emphasized.
